Pītau-Allenvale School is a small state specialist school located in Belfast, Christchurch. The school had 134 students enrolled as of April 2026. Its Equity Index (EQI) of 466 is above the Christchurch average, indicating greater socioeconomic diversity among students. The school has an open enrolment scheme and welcomes applications from students at any address.
